Latest Patents

Mylius holds a patent for a heat-resistant lining for walls, specifically designed for helicopter engine compartments. The invention addresses the challenge of protecting the pilot's cabin from excessive heat generated by the engine. The dividing wall is constructed from fiberglass, which is not suitable for temperatures exceeding 200 degrees Celsius. To enhance its heat resistance, the wall is lined with one or more liner blankets made of a mineral fiber felt core, a metal foil front layer, and a glass fiber fabric rear layer. These components are quilted together and bound around the edges, ensuring a compressible margin that prevents unprotected gaps when multiple blankets are used.
